The Interstate Batteries 12V 100Ah 31M-AGM Marine/RV Battery is designed as a dual-purpose battery, meaning it can both start engines and provide steady, long-lasting power for accessories. This makes it a good choice for those needing reliable deep-cycle performance for dump trailers, boats, or RVs. It uses pure lead AGM technology, which offers a longer life—about two to three times that of typical AGM or flooded batteries—and faster recharging.
The battery capacity of 100Ah is solid for extended use, and its design with thick plates supports frequent deep discharges without quickly wearing out. At 72 pounds and roughly 13 x 7 x 9.5 inches, it’s a bit heavy and bulky, so handling and fitting should be considered. Maintenance is low since AGM batteries are sealed and don’t require water refilling.
If you're looking for a tough, long-lasting battery that can handle both cranking and deep-cycle needs on your dump trailer or similar equipment, this Interstate model is a trustworthy pick, especially if you prioritize lifespan and maintenance ease over weight.

The Renogy Deep Cycle AGM Battery offers a solid 12V 200Ah capacity, making it well-suited for powering dump trailers and similar equipment that require steady, reliable energy over long periods. Its AGM (Absorbent Glass Mat) design means it’s maintenance-free—no watering or acid handling—which is convenient for hassle-free use. The battery features a low self-discharge rate of about 3% per month, so it holds charge well even if not used frequently. It supports high discharge currents, useful for jump-starting or demanding power draws, and handles a wide range of temperatures, performing reliably even in cold weather (below freezing).
In terms of size and weight, it’s quite hefty at nearly 128 pounds and about 20 inches long, so consider space and mounting options on your trailer. The battery should last for many charge-discharge cycles if used properly due to its design and materials. One limitation is that it should be installed upright to avoid damage, which might restrict placement flexibility.
This Renogy battery provides a dependable, low-maintenance power solution for dump trailer owners, especially those needing a robust battery capable of withstanding varying climates.

The Interstate Batteries Marine/RV Battery 12V 70Ah is a sealed lead-acid AGM battery designed for dual use in boats and RVs, which can also suit dump trailers that require reliable deep-cycle power. Its 70 amp-hour capacity and 12-volt output provide a good balance of power and endurance for moderate energy needs, though it may not support very heavy or long-term deep cycling compared to specialized deep-cycle batteries. The pure lead AGM design means it is maintenance-free and spill-proof, making it convenient and safe to use in various positions.
Weighing about 48 pounds and sized as a Group 24M battery, it is reasonably portable but might be bulky for very small trailer compartments. The battery's sealed construction also helps it handle temperature variations better than regular flooded batteries, which is useful if you operate in different climates. This battery is primarily marketed as a marine and RV starting battery, so while it offers some cycle life, it may not have the extensive cycle durability of batteries specifically made for deep-cycle trailer use.
If you need a solid, low-maintenance battery with good starting power and moderate cycle capability, this Interstate battery is a reliable choice, but for heavy-duty or very frequent deep cycling, looking at dedicated deep-cycle batteries might be better.
